How they compare
Sudan (former) currently reports 90,766 t against 70,759 t in Netherlands (Kingdom of the), a difference of 20,007 t.
That makes Sudan (former)'s figure about 1.3 times Netherlands (Kingdom of the)'s.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 51 shared years of data; in 1961 it was Netherlands (Kingdom of the) ahead.
Netherlands (Kingdom of the) ranks 41st and Sudan (former) ranks 38th of 186 countries.
Across the 6 decades both report, Netherlands (Kingdom of the) averaged higher in 5 and Sudan (former) in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Netherlands (Kingdom of the) | Sudan (former) |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 87,220 t | 4,261 t | 82,959 t | Netherlands (Kingdom of the) |
| 1970s | 98,741 t | 5,348 t | 93,392 t | Netherlands (Kingdom of the) |
| 1980s | 114,369 t | 8,928 t | 105,441 t | Netherlands (Kingdom of the) |
| 1990s | 107,560 t | 26,953 t | 80,607 t | Netherlands (Kingdom of the) |
| 2000s | 88,221 t | 33,732 t | 54,488 t | Netherlands (Kingdom of the) |
| 2010s | 82,945 t | 91,067 t | 8,121 t | Sudan (former) |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
The Cropland Nutrient balance domain contains information on the flows of nitrogen, phosphorus, and potassium from mineral fertilizer, manure applied, atmospheric deposition, crop removal, and biological fixation over cropland and per unit area of cropland. The flows are aggregated to total inputs and total outputs, from which the overall nutrient balance and nutrient use efficiency on cropland are calculated. Statistics are disseminated in units of tonnes and in kg/ha, as appropriate. Nutrient use efficiency is expressed as a fraction (%).
